Web6 feb. 2024 · Divide the number of blue marbles into the total: 12/30 = 0.4 Multiple this value by 100 to get the percent: 0.4 x 100 = 40% are blue You have two ways to determine what percent are not blue. The easiest is to take the total percent minus the percent that are blue: 100% - 40% = 60% not blue. WebHow to calculate a percentage increase or decrease.
